MS-HUG announces finalists in annual awards
CHICAGO and REDMOND, Wash. – Microsoft Healthcare Users Group (MS-HUG)
and Microsoft Corp. have announced 28 finalists for the eighth annual
MS-HUG awards, which showcase the most innovative solutions and
customers of Microsoft technology in the healthcare industry.
The honors are awarded by MS-HUG, a membership community of the
Healthcare Information and Management Systems Society (HIMSS), in
recognition of the significant contributions being made by organizations
and individuals to improve the quality of patient care.
The awards include recognition for hospitals, clinics, health plans and
leading healthcare providers that demonstrate the best use of
Microsoft-based products in the patient care arena. Also honored are
leading independent software vendors (ISVs) developing solutions on
Microsoft technology to address the diverse challenges faced by the
healthcare industry. Award contestants in this category are evaluated on
the extent to which they provide significant business benefits to
healthcare organizations and improve patient care.

The 2005 category finalists for the MS-HUG annual awards are as follows:
Microsoft Customer Awards Finalists
Microsoft Clinic of the Year
Affinity Health Group, Tifton, Ga.
Center for Assisted Reproduction, Bedford, Texas
Ogden Clinic, Ogden, Utah
Microsoft Health Plan of the Year
Highmark Inc., Pittsburgh
Partnership HealthPlan of California, Fairfield, Calif.
Premera Blue Cross, Mountlake Terrace, Wash.
Microsoft Hospital of the Year
Alamance Regional Medical Center, Burlington, N.C.
Norton Healthcare, Louisville, Ky.
Truman Medical Centers Inc., Kansas City, Mo.
Microsoft Nurse of the Year
Monica Andrews, RN, Center for Assisted Reproduction, Bedford, Texas
Mindy Jones, Affinity Health Group, Tifton, Ga.
Lori Reynolds, BSN, Fairview Health Services, Minneapolis
Microsoft Physician of the Year
Kevin J. Doody, M.D., Center for Assisted Reproduction, Bedford, Texas
Craig F. Feied, M.D., FACEP, FAAEM; National Institute for Medical
Informatics and MedStar Health, Washington
E. Monty Stirman, M.D., Holston Medical Group, Kingsport, Tenn.
Healthcare ISV Finalists
AdministrativeFinancial Systems
Allscripts, IMPACT.MD
API Software Inc., Payrollmation Series Time and Attendance System
NextGen Healthcare Information Systems Inc., NextGen EPM
Acute Care: ClinicalPatient Information Systems
dbMotion Ltd., The dbMotion System
Picis Inc., CareSuite
Stentor Inc., iSite Enterprise Picture Archiving Communication Systems
Ambulatory Care: Clinical Patient Information Systems
Allscripts, Touchworks
iMedica Corp., iMedica PhysicianSuite
MedInformatix Inc., MedInformatix
NextGen Healthcare Information Systems, NextGen EMR
Enabling Technologies
Galvanon Inc., MediKiosk CVM Enterprise Server
Gold Standard, eMPOWERx
Midmark Diagnostics Group, IQmark Digital ECG PDA
